Output d4c8dd96bdd889a0a9d1da8efa2f0a4dad56beb4e261c21b33a35c40e430bff5:0

value
26120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98893b21037faa00e726b9b795e51bb97c1e8a51 OP_EQUAL
address
3FbZ2gE3BzfJeGVfh7B69gpq3ZD7NhVp6D
transaction
d4c8dd96bdd889a0a9d1da8efa2f0a4dad56beb4e261c21b33a35c40e430bff5